When you’re shopping for or selling a home in Douglas County, having a knowledgeable real estate agent by your side can make all the difference. The county, located in the state of Colorado, affords quite a lot of residential options, from suburban neighborhoods to rural properties. To navigate the competitive and often complicated market, it’s essential to understand the function of real estate agents and find out how to discover the right one in your needs.  
  
The Importance of a Real Estate Agent in Douglas County  
  
Douglas County is one among Colorado’s fastest-growing areas, attracting each newcomers and long-time residents looking for a change of scenery. With its proximity to Denver, diverse housing options, and plentiful natural beauty, it’s no surprise that the real estate market is bustling. Nonetheless, the market’s activity can make it challenging for individuals to seek out the right property or get the best deal.  
  
Real estate agents are geared up with local market knowledge, negotiation skills, and expertise navigating the complexities of property transactions. They assist streamline the process by advising on pricing, making ready gives, and guiding you through legal paperwork. Whether you're a first-time homebuyer or an skilled investor, working with an agent can provide you a competitive edge.  
  
Understanding the Function of a Real Estate Agent  
  
Earlier than choosing an agent, it’s important to understand their function and how they can help you. Real estate agents in Douglas County typically work in one among capacities:  
  
1. Buyer’s Agents: If you’re purchasing a house, a buyer’s agent will signify your interests. They’ll enable you to discover properties that meet your needs and budget, arrange showings, and guide you through the bidding process. They will additionally negotiate terms in your behalf and advise you on making a suggestion that stands out.  
  
2. Seller’s Agents (Listing Agents): In the event you’re selling your house, a seller’s agent will list your property, market it to potential buyers, and handle the negotiation process. They’ll help determine a competitive listing price, coordinate open houses, and manage presents to make sure you get the best value for your property.  
  
The right way to Choose the Proper Real Estate Agent  
  
Choosing the suitable real estate agent is crucial to a smooth and profitable transaction. Here are some ideas that can assist you find the best fit:  
  
1. Local Experience: Douglas County’s real estate market can be distinctive, with completely different trends depending on the neighborhood or town. Look for an agent who has in-depth knowledge of the world, together with market conditions, local amenities, and the types of homes available.  
  
2. Experience and Reputation: Expertise issues when it comes to real estate. An experienced agent has likely dealt with a range of situations and might anticipate potential hurdles in the course of the transaction. It’s additionally necessary to check their popularity—ask for referrals from friends or family, read on-line evaluations, and check their professional credentials.  
  
3. Communication Skills: The shopping for or selling process may be irritating, and it’s essential to work with an agent who communicates clearly and promptly. They need to be attentive to your questions and considerations, keeping you up to date each step of the way.  
  
4. Compatibility: Real estate transactions are personal, and you’ll wish to work with an agent you are feeling comfortable with. Select someone who listens to your wants, understands your priorities, and is patient throughout the process.  
  
What to Anticipate When Working with an Agent  
  
Once you’ve chosen your real estate agent, the process will vary depending on whether you’re buying or selling a home. Here’s what you may count on:  
  
1. Initial Consultation: Your agent will start by meeting with you to understand your goals. For buyers, they’ll talk about what type of home you’re looking for and your budget. For sellers, they’ll evaluate your property and suggest a pricing strategy.  
  
2. Property Search or Marketing: Buyers will be shown properties that match their criteria. Sellers will work with the agent to stage and photograph the property, which will be listed on multiple platforms to draw potential buyers.  
  
3. Negotiations and Affords: When gives start coming in, your agent will allow you to assess them, counteroffer when necessary, and negotiate the terms. Their expertise in negotiation can ensure you get one of the best deal.  
  
4. Closing Process: The closing process involves quite a lot of paperwork and legal requirements. Your agent will help in guaranteeing everything is accomplished appropriately and on time, reducing the probabilities of delays or complications.
